How Supplied
Sterilised drops (7.5ml) in plastic bottle with COMOD valve system.
Dosing
ECP/HCP to advise. Generally 1 drop three times daily on each affected eye. Contact Lenses do not need to be removed. "If necessary product can be used more frequently under recommendation of ophthalmologist/optician". "Suitable for long term treatment".

Formulation
Sterile Preservative Free Phosphate Free solution containing:, Sodium Hyaluranate 0.1%, Dexpanthenol 2%, Citrate buffer, Water, Osmolarity 240 - 290mOsm/kg*, Viscosity 10cps*.
Contact Lens Use
Yes, if required.
Indications
Dry Eye. Tear film Hyperosmolarity. "Dry Eye with injury". "For lubrication that can support healing of damaged epithelium due to dry eye or surgical procedures".
Contra-Indications/Cautions
Hypersensitivity to product/class/component. Pregnancy/lactation - EDDB. Pt to wait between 30 minutes between other drop applications. Pt to use product after other drops, but before ointments. Discard 6 months after first use. Store at room temperature. Advise pt to read and understand all accompanying product information before first use - EDDB.
Adverse Reactions
"Rare: Burning, stinging - if symptoms persist pt to stop use and seek advice". If vision changes or irritation occurs, persists or increases, pt to discontinue use and consult ECP/HCP.
